摘要The paper attempts to examine the relationships botween industrial organizations and their environments from an essentially spatial perspective and organizational theory, and inteqrate the generalizations derived from organizational theory and industrial geography o identify spatial linkage pattems created by the enterprises, both in the aggregate and individually These issues are organized around three elements. From the many organizational and environmental factors which might influence the spatial linkage patterns, six have been selected for analysis. These factors were highly correlated with value or volume of spatial linkages. Changes of spatial linkage pattems over time were analyzed based on a representative sample of the Nanjing Automotive Industrial Corporation, and findings with case studies were illustrated.
摘要Since 1960 research in the geography of enterprise hasexpanded dramatically. This review gives a critical analysis of the geography of enterprise around five main facets. Firstly, it briefs five approaches adopted by the geography of enterprise. This is followed by an examination of its main development stops. The third section analyses its major research areas. Some new research trends make up the fourth section. Based on the above review many new theoretical and practical problems needed to be solved urgently for the geography of enterprise in China are posed.
